We are looking for an individual who is passionate about a career in law to join us as Campus Rep, taking on a leading role promoting our professional postgraduate courses at your university and driving attendance to open days and events.

To be eligible to apply you need to either be a student studying a law degree at one of the universities listed below:

  • Hull
  • Sheffield
  • Newcastle

Or a student studying a non-law degree at one of the universities listed below, you will raise awareness of the opportunities available to pursue a legal career from a non-law background:

  • Newcastle

This is a fantastic opportunity to develop your marketing, communication, and networking skills. In this role you will be responsible for:

  • Raising awareness and ensuring a high attendance at The University of Law’s events, presentations and workshops taking place at your campus and at The University of Law.
  • Answering questions about The University of Law.
  • Networking with law and non-law student societies, faculties, and careers departments.
  • Maintaining and managing an effective communications strategy, including through lecture shout‑outs, emails and by taking ownership of your local Campus Rep Instagram.
